Were loading the tortoise and heading out into the Dale district, going to see if the chinese still have all the hard rock mining in the dale area claimed up, we loaded the drywasher, the guys werent to happy about that, I bartered with them and told them they can take there head lamps and go underground, if we can do 50 buckets through the drywasher, we have to see what happens.
We havnt been out in the Dale since september, We usally mine the dale district, as we live a few miles from there. We have had a lot of sucsess out there in the past 20 years and know just about every inch of the place.

We mined all summer out there when we finally had enough of the bees, it was a bad year for bees i got stung about 30 times in a couple of differant attacks.
It was a bad year in the Dale for hard rock gold also, with big foreign mining companys claiming up all the good zones. We did manage a couple of ounces but it was rough puting it together.

With any luck the chinese will have figured out that they werent going to get enough gold out there, to even pay for the work theve done so far, Theres barely enough hardrock for one miner to make a living from.
So were off to the Dale for a few days of prospecting, drywash and explore and see if the chinese are still there. We have a bunch of spots that weve found for drywashing we are going to see if anybody has found them yet. It would nice to see the chinese gone I know where a couple sizable pockets are out on there claims.
